Job summary

As Deputy Chief Pharmacist , you will play a pivotal role in leading, developing, and delivering safe, effective, and innovative pharmacy services across our hospitals. Working closely with the chief pharmacist and pharmacy board, you'll help drive our new trust strategy in matters related to medicines optimisation , support national priorities, and ensure regulatory compliance. Act as thesites'expert inmedicinesoptimisation, with delegatedresponsibility from thechiefpharmacist. Deputise for thechiefpharmacistto provide strategic and professional leadershipformedicines optimisation services across the trustand to externalcustomers. Ensure pharmacy services are patient-centred, safe, progressive, cost-effective, and delivered within agreed budgets by competent staff. Drive continuous improvement and innovation in pharmacy services, embedding quality improvement and R&I principles. Lead and manage strategic project planning for pharmacy services, assessing resource requirements and potential impact across thetrust. Positively influence stakeholders to achievehigh standardsin medicines optimisation across the organisation. Lead on business planning, formulating cases of need andsubmittingbids for procurement ofadditionalresources based on evaluation, research, quotations andestablishedcontracts. Appraise and evaluate service delivery and role development. Represent the pharmacy department attrust committees and collaborate with internal and external stakeholders, such as other NHS trusts and Integrated Care Boards (ICBs). Delegated management ofallocatedpharmacy budget for RSCH and PRH pharmacy. Member ofpharmacyboard.
